    Definitely entertaining for the little kids, and indoors with a three-story jungle gym that kept…read morethe kids running and shouting and enjoying their own games that they make up on the spot. The ball pit, inflatable toys, and slides are entertaining for enough hours that they want to stay longer than you think. Yes, the $20 a session for 1+yr old is a little on the higher side for one kid and an adult, but considering what you'd spend at a Chucky Cheese, it's similar. They have wi-fi for adults to sit with their phones, and an area in the back for only toddlers and bathrooms. No shoes inside, so bring socks or you'll have to buy them. And you can hold parties here, a 3hr time for the various packages/days, so you can definitely hold a birthday or two here. A small room with sound, and chairs - enough seating for around 10-13 kids comfortably, and they handle drinks, and food, etc., too. Also some toys upfront if you want to buy those.

    This is the perfect place for children and babies age 4 and younger. The owner of this place really…read morehas an eye for detail that is rare for an indoor playspace. First off she provides bibs hanging in the eating area to use as we all know kids get food everywhere on them at this age. The bathroom has several sizes of attached seat covers so newly trained kids can easily use the toilet, a changing table- and most of all, free diapers organized and labeled by different sizes! This is unheard of but such a lifesaver. Now for the playspace itself. It's new, clean, well laid out with lots of options including a book room, painting and drawing table, slide with climber, dolls, play kitchen and various other small movement items. The painting area is also very well organized and labeled. It's never been too crowded and I've gone twice on weekends. Only bummer is lack of parking but you can park in the Burger King Parking lot if there are no spots behind the building. Reservations recommended but not required.

    I'm always in search of newer and better indoor playground. Royal Magic Castle has got to rank in…read morethe current top 2 or 3. Huge modern play area, sand room, laser tag and arcade room including claw machines. The admission price is a bit pricey compared to others, open play costs $42.99 + tax for kids 3 feet and taller and 1 adult. Additional adults cost $18.99 each. It does include unlimited time as others are usually 2 hours max and it includes laser tag. Place is very large, has drinks and a small gift shop (toys, gifts etc). Place is modern and clean for now... until the next new indoor playground ground opens up.
